How to Play a Slot Online

Online slots are casino games that operate on a random number generator and can award payouts based on the symbols displayed. They can come in different shapes and sizes but most options work the same way. Players place a bet and then spin the reels to earn prizes. They can also trigger bonus features and other ways to win, depending on the theme of the game. The games can be very addictive and are a popular choice among players of all ages. They can be played from a computer, tablet, or mobile device.

When it comes to online slots, the old rule is “quit while you’re ahead.” The more you play, the less likely you are to walk away a winner. This is especially true with branded slots, which typically have lower RTPs than non-branded games. This is because software providers need to pay a copyright fee for each branded slot they produce.

It’s important to read the paytable before playing a slot online. You can find this information on the game’s page at the casino. It will provide you with a list of all the symbols available in the slot, and how they pay out. The paytable will also display the maximum bet and the maximum amount you can win. This will help you to decide how much to bet and which games are right for your budget.
